What is the RASFF system? 

The Rapid Alert System for Food and Feed (RASFF) is an information network connecting the control authorities of EU Member States and central institutions. Its main task is to ensure that any information regarding a detected health threat – whether microbiological, chemical, or physical – is immediately transmitted to all market participants¹. This enables coordinated corrective actions to be taken before the product reaches the consumer’s table.

Precision and Transparency in Action 

At the heart of the system is transparency. As soon as a national control body detects food that does not meet strict EU standards, it generates a notification that enters a database accessible to all countries in the network. The system categorises incidents into:

Alerts: When a product posing a serious risk is already on the market and requires immediate action (e.g., a recall).

Information: When a risk has been identified, but the product is not yet in circulation or the threat is lower.

Border Rejections: When customs control stops a product from outside the EU, preventing its entry into the single market¹.

Why is RASFF a Guarantee of Quality? 

The presence of the RASFF system is proof that European food is subject to constant, multi-level verification. It is not merely a crisis response system, but primarily a preventive tool. Continuous monitoring allows for:

Rapid elimination of threats: Response time is measured in hours, minimising the impact of any irregularities.

Building stable supply chains: Trade partners from other continents can be certain that EU-certified products come from an area with a high degree of sanitary supervision².

High consistency of standards: Constant pressure from inspections forces producers to maintain high technological regimes.

The RASFF system is the foundation of the European food safety model. Thanks to it, national borders are no barrier to the flow of information, and “farm to fork” standards receive real, technical support!
